How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ophir?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ophir Studio Apartments | $1,502 | $1,305 | $2,100 |
Ophir 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,685 | $1,252 | $2,195 |
Ophir 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,312 | $1,550 | $3,178 |
Ophir 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,667 | $2,500 | $3,395 |
Ophir 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,995 | $3,995 | $3,995 |

Largest Available Ophir and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Ophir, CO is found at Gauge in the Hawks Nest neighborhood and is 1,005 square feet priced from $2,246. Basecamp has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 995 square feet and currently listed start at $1,955.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Ophir: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Gauge | B1 | 1,005 Sq Ft | $2,246 |
Basecamp | Two Bedroom | 995 Sq Ft | $1,955 |
Skyline Apartments | B1 | 784 Sq Ft | $2,015 |
Cheapest Available Ophir and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 09,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Ophir, CO is the B1J Model starting from $1,660 at Red Cliff in the Hawks Nest neighborhood. The second most affordable Ophir 2 Bedroom is the Two Bedroom Model at Basecamp starting at $1,955 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Ophir is currently $2,312.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Ophir: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Red Cliff | B1J | $1,660 |
Basecamp | Two Bedroom | $1,955 |
Skyline Apartments | B1 | $2,015 |
Gauge | B1 | $2,246 |
